When we talk about Indian fashion we usually imagine traditional wear with sarees, dupattas, kurti, and other beautiful items. Yet modern fashion isn’t limited to that! If you look at Bollywood stars you’ll notice that there’s a huge mixing trend going on. Western style of clothing that is so popular all over the world, including India, gets merged with elegant Indian garments, creating a beautiful new style that is both hip and sophisticated. And not only that, new fashion trends call for experiments, bold fashion statements, and unique colour combinations. Here are 9 fashion tips every Indian girl should follow.

Mix with denim

If you follow Sonam Kapoor, you know that the latest trend is merging traditional Indian wear with denim. It’s comfy, modern, and edgy in a very sophisticated way. If you’re tired of wearing saree everywhere or want to wear one, but in a more comfortable way, try wearing half saree with a pair of jeans. If a Bollywood diva can pull it off, you can do it, too! It’s all the rage in the fashion world right now.

Pair your kurti with a skirt

You’ve probably never thought of wearing your kurti with something other than salwaar and churidra, but rest assured kurti looks just as great with a bold printed skirt. You can also go for a plain kurti and skirt, pairing it with a gorgeous printed shawl. Throw in some must-have Indian-style accessories, and you’re good to go!

Go for a fabric jacket

Leather jackets are last century fashion! Now it’s time to rock some of those gorgeous fabric jackets that come in all shapes, colors, and styles. Boho jackets, ethnic jackets, jackets with beautiful embroidery and jackets with crazy prints… there’s so much to try! Of course, denim jackets are among the coolest and they’re making a huge comeback as we speak. If you like to wear bold jackets, make sure the rest of your outfit isn’t too gaudy. Keep it simple!

Wear dhoti pants

If you’re looking for a truly modern Desi look, then look no further! Go to the nearest shop and grab yourself a few pairs of stylish dhoti pants because they’re hitting the fashion world big right now. From hip college girls to Bollywood divas and house wives – everyone is trying out the new style! You can wear them with various tops or tees, pairing with comfy sneakers or elegant shoes. You can style them anyway you want!

Wrap your dupatta in a different way

There’s hardly an Indian girl out there that doesn’t wear a dupatta. It’s gorgeous, comfy, and can be combined with either Indian or Western style clothing. But now it’s time to experiment with this gorgeous garment! Try wrapping it in a different way and make sure it looks good with your attire. If you have prints and statement pieces then it’s best to go for a plain dupatta. If you’re wearing simple designs, then you can go all the way with an over-the-top dupatta that will tie the whole look together.

Wear your kurti as a jacket

Yes, kurtis are becoming more versatile and flexible as to what you can pair them with. If you happen to own a kurti with an open front, it can easily become a type of jacket! Wear your favourite denims, a simple top, and that gorgeous kurti of yours. It will look fresh, unusual, but totally Indian!

Up your saree game

If you can’t imagine your life without a saree but feel you need to somehow up your game in this department, and then go for the new printed sarees that have all kinds of designs from playful florals to stripes and circles. You can also opt for an elegant plain-coloured saree to keep your look low-key. Add some beautiful accessories to create a more Bollywood-esque look. Oh, and don’t forget to wear a crop top instead of saree blouse!

Try a waist belt

Belts are among those accessories that just never go out of trend. Now it’s time to get back to high waisted belts. You can pair them with anything now! Dresses, sarees, kurtis… wear them any way you want as long as you remember the golden rule – choose an ornamented belt if your look is casual or basic, go for a simple belt if your look incorporates prints. Leather belts look really good with boho outfits.

Accessorise with Jhumkas

When we talk about accessories, Jhumkas are widely underestimated. They might have drifted away for a while, but now they’re back with more designs than ever. It’s a must have for any Desi look! Indian fashion has ignored these gorgeous Jhumkas for quite some time, but now they’re making a comeback. Make sure you try the cool-looking tribal designs!
